Position Summary

The Pre-Engineered Metal Building (PEMB) Erector is responsible for safely assembling, erecting, and installing structural steel systems, metal building components, roofing systems, wall panels, insulation, doors, windows, and related building systems for Southwest Building Solutions projects. This position plays a vital role in delivering safe, high-quality construction while supporting efficient project execution and exceptional customer satisfaction.

Working under the direction of a Foreman, the PEMB Erector performs skilled construction work while collaborating with fellow crew members to complete projects in accordance with construction drawings, manufacturer specifications, company quality standards, and project schedules.

Success in this role requires mechanical aptitude, construction knowledge, a strong commitment to safety, attention to detail, teamwork, and the ability to perform physically demanding work in a variety of outdoor conditions.

Essential Functions

Building Erection & Installation

  • Assemble and erect pre-engineered metal building systems in accordance with approved construction drawings and manufacturer specifications.
  • Install primary and secondary structural steel components.
  • Install roof systems, wall panels, trim, insulation, doors, windows, vents, and related building components.
  • Perform layout, alignment, and fastening of structural members.
  • Verify proper fit and alignment throughout installation.

Structural Assembly

  • Read and interpret construction drawings, erection plans, and installation details.
  • Assist with structural steel alignment, bolting, and final assembly.
  • Safely guide structural components during crane operations.
  • Assemble rigging and hoisting equipment in accordance with established safety procedures.
  • Assist with field modifications when approved by project leadership.

Equipment Operation

  • Safely operate aerial lifts, scissor lifts, boom lifts, forklifts, telehandlers, and other approved construction equipment.
  • Perform daily equipment inspections before operation.
  • Report equipment deficiencies immediately.
  • Properly secure and maintain company tools and equipment.

Quality Workmanship

  • Complete work in accordance with company quality standards and project specifications.
  • Verify installed components meet layout, alignment, and installation requirements.
  • Identify workmanship concerns and communicate issues to the Foreman.
  • Participate in punch list completion and final quality inspections.
  • Maintain pride in craftsmanship throughout every phase of construction.

Safety

  • Follow all company safety policies, OSHA regulations, and fall protection requirements.
  • Properly use all required personal protective equipment (PPE).
  • Participate in daily Job Hazard Analyses (JHAs), toolbox talks, and safety meetings.
  • Identify unsafe conditions and immediately report hazards.
  • Exercise stop-work authority whenever unsafe conditions exist.
  • Maintain clean and organized work areas throughout each project.

Material & Equipment Handling

  • Load, unload, stage, and organize construction materials.
  • Safely move materials using approved equipment and rigging methods.
  • Protect materials from damage during storage and installation.
  • Maintain accountability for company tools and equipment.
